What Specifications Should You Consider When Choosing Memory for a Z390 ITX Motherboard?
When choosing memory for a Z390 ITX motherboard, several specifications should be considered to ensure optimal performance and compatibility.
- Memory Type: The Z390 ITX motherboard typically supports DDR4 memory, which offers faster speeds and improved efficiency compared to previous generations.
- Memory Speed: It is important to select RAM with appropriate speeds, commonly ranging from 2400 MHz to 3200 MHz or higher, as this can significantly affect system performance.
- Capacity: Depending on your use case, memory capacity can range from 8GB to 32GB or more; however, 16GB is generally recommended for gaming and multitasking.
- Form Factor: Ensure that the RAM sticks are in the DIMM form factor compatible with the ITX motherboard, as some smaller motherboards may have specific slot configurations.
- Latency: The CAS latency of the memory is important, with lower numbers indicating faster response times—look for a balance between latency and speed for the best performance.
- Dual Channel Support: Utilizing dual-channel memory configurations can enhance performance, so consider purchasing RAM in matched pairs to take advantage of this feature.
- Voltage: Most DDR4 RAM operates at 1.2V, but ensuring compatibility with any overclocked configurations or specific motherboard requirements is crucial.
- Heat Spreaders: RAM with heat spreaders can help manage temperatures during intensive tasks, which is especially important for compact builds where airflow may be limited.
- Compatibility: Always check the motherboard’s QVL (Qualified Vendor List) for verified RAM modules to ensure compatibility and reliability.

How Do Timings and Latencies Influence RAM Performance on a Z390 ITX Motherboard?
Timings and latencies play a crucial role in determining the RAM performance on a Z390 ITX motherboard.
- CAS Latency (CL): CAS latency is the delay time between the moment a memory controller tells the RAM to access a particular column in a row and the moment the data is available. Lower CAS latency numbers indicate faster response times, which can lead to improved overall system performance, especially in tasks that require rapid data retrieval.
- Timing Parameters (e.g., 16-18-18-36): These parameters describe the delays associated with various memory operations, including row precharge time, active to precharge delay, and others. The lower the values in these timing specifications, the less time the RAM takes to execute commands, resulting in better performance, particularly in latency-sensitive applications.
- Memory Frequency (MHz): The frequency of RAM determines how fast the memory can transfer data to and from the CPU. Higher frequency RAM, such as 3000MHz or 3200MHz, can significantly enhance overall performance, particularly in memory-intensive tasks like gaming and content creation, when paired with a compatible Z390 ITX motherboard.
- Bandwidth: This refers to the amount of data that can be transferred to and from the RAM in a given time period, typically measured in MB/s. Higher bandwidth, which is achieved through higher frequencies and optimal timings, allows for more data to be processed simultaneously, improving performance in multi-threaded applications and gaming.
- Dual-Channel Configuration: Utilizing a dual-channel configuration, where two sticks of RAM are installed, can effectively double the memory bandwidth available to the CPU. This setup is particularly beneficial for Z390 ITX motherboards, which support dual-channel memory architecture, providing a noticeable performance increase in certain applications and gaming scenarios.
